diff --git a/runtime/openjdkjvmti/object_tagging.cc b/runtime/openjdkjvmti/object_tagging.cc
new file mode 100644
index 0000000..bb17cac
--- /dev/null
+++ b/runtime/openjdkjvmti/object_tagging.cc
@@ -0,0 +1,127 @@
+/* Copyright (C) 2016 The Android Open Source Project
+ * DO NOT ALTER OR REMOVE COPYRIGHT NOTICES OR THIS FILE HEADER.
+ *
+ * This file implements interfaces from the file jvmti.h. This implementation
+ * is licensed under the same terms as the file jvmti.h.  The
+ * copyright and license information for the file jvmti.h follows.
+ *
+ * Copyright (c) 2003, 2011, Oracle and/or its affiliates. All rights reserved.
+ * DO NOT ALTER OR REMOVE COPYRIGHT NOTICES OR THIS FILE HEADER.
+ *
+ * This code is free software; you can redistribute it and/or modify it
+ * under the terms of the GNU General Public License version 2 only, as
+ * published by the Free Software Foundation.  Oracle designates this
+ * particular file as subject to the "Classpath" exception as provided
+ * by Oracle in the LICENSE file that accompanied this code.
+ *
+ * This code is distributed in the hope that it will be useful, but WITHOUT
+ * ANY WARRANTY; without even the implied warranty of MERCHANTABILITY or
+ * FITNESS FOR A PARTICULAR PURPOSE.  See the GNU General Public License
+ * version 2 for more details (a copy is included in the LICENSE file that
+ * accompanied this code).
+ *
+ * You should have received a copy of the GNU General Public License version
+ * 2 along with this work; if not, write to the Free Software Foundation,
+ * Inc., 51 Franklin St, Fifth Floor, Boston, MA 02110-1301 USA.
+ *
+ * Please contact Oracle, 500 Oracle Parkway, Redwood Shores, CA 94065 USA
+ * or visit www.oracle.com if you need additional information or have any
+ * questions.
+ */
+
+#include "object_tagging.h"
+
+#include "art_jvmti.h"
+#include "base/logging.h"
+#include "events-inl.h"
+#include "gc/allocation_listener.h"
+#include "instrumentation.h"
+#include "jni_env_ext-inl.h"
+#include "mirror/class.h"
+#include "mirror/object.h"
+#include "runtime.h"
+#include "ScopedLocalRef.h"
+
+namespace openjdkjvmti {
+
+void ObjectTagTable::Add(art::mirror::Object* obj, jlong tag) {
+  art::Thread* self = art::Thread::Current();
+  art::MutexLock mu(self, allow_disallow_lock_);
+  Wait(self);
+
+  if (first_free_ == tagged_objects_.size()) {
+    tagged_objects_.push_back(Entry(art::GcRoot<art::mirror::Object>(obj), tag));
+    first_free_++;
+  } else {
+    DCHECK_LT(first_free_, tagged_objects_.size());
+    DCHECK(tagged_objects_[first_free_].first.IsNull());
+    tagged_objects_[first_free_] = Entry(art::GcRoot<art::mirror::Object>(obj), tag);
+    // TODO: scan for free elements.
+    first_free_ = tagged_objects_.size();
+  }
+}
+
+bool ObjectTagTable::Remove(art::mirror::Object* obj, jlong* tag) {
+  art::Thread* self = art::Thread::Current();
+  art::MutexLock mu(self, allow_disallow_lock_);
+  Wait(self);
+
+  for (auto it = tagged_objects_.begin(); it != tagged_objects_.end(); ++it) {
+    if (it->first.Read(nullptr) == obj) {
+      if (tag != nullptr) {
+        *tag = it->second;
+      }
+      it->first = art::GcRoot<art::mirror::Object>(nullptr);
+
+      size_t index = it - tagged_objects_.begin();
+      if (index < first_free_) {
+        first_free_ = index;
+      }
+
+      // TODO: compaction.
+
+      return true;
+    }
+  }
+
+  return false;
+}
+
+void ObjectTagTable::Sweep(art::IsMarkedVisitor* visitor) {
+  if (event_handler_->IsEventEnabledAnywhere(JVMTI_EVENT_OBJECT_FREE)) {
+    SweepImpl<true>(visitor);
+  } else {
+    SweepImpl<false>(visitor);
+  }
+}
+
+template <bool kHandleNull>
+void ObjectTagTable::SweepImpl(art::IsMarkedVisitor* visitor) {
+  art::Thread* self = art::Thread::Current();
+  art::MutexLock mu(self, allow_disallow_lock_);
+
+  for (auto it = tagged_objects_.begin(); it != tagged_objects_.end(); ++it) {
+    if (!it->first.IsNull()) {
+      art::mirror::Object* original_obj = it->first.Read<art::kWithoutReadBarrier>();
+      art::mirror::Object* target_obj = visitor->IsMarked(original_obj);
+      if (original_obj != target_obj) {
+        it->first = art::GcRoot<art::mirror::Object>(target_obj);
+
+        if (kHandleNull && target_obj == nullptr) {
+          HandleNullSweep(it->second);
+        }
+      }
+    } else {
+      size_t index = it - tagged_objects_.begin();
+      if (index < first_free_) {
+        first_free_ = index;
+      }
+    }
+  }
+}
+
+void ObjectTagTable::HandleNullSweep(jlong tag) {
+  event_handler_->DispatchEvent(nullptr, JVMTI_EVENT_OBJECT_FREE, tag);
+}
+
+}  // namespace openjdkjvmti

diff --git a/test/905-object-free/src/Main.java b/test/905-object-free/src/Main.java
new file mode 100644
index 0000000..7b52e29
--- /dev/null
+++ b/test/905-object-free/src/Main.java
@@ -0,0 +1,72 @@
+/*
+ * Copyright (C) 2016 The Android Open Source Project
+ *
+ * Licensed under the Apache License, Version 2.0 (the "License");
+ * you may not use this file except in compliance with the License.
+ * You may obtain a copy of the License at
+ *
+ *      http://www.apache.org/licenses/LICENSE-2.0
+ *
+ * Unless required by applicable law or agreed to in writing, software
+ * distributed under the License is distributed on an "AS IS" BASIS,
+ * WITHOUT WARRANTIES OR CONDITIONS OF ANY KIND, either express or implied.
+ * See the License for the specific language governing permissions and
+ * limitations under the License.
+ */
+
+import java.util.ArrayList;
+
+public class Main {
+  public static void main(String[] args) throws Exception {
+    System.loadLibrary(args[1]);
+
+    doTest();
+  }
+
+  public static void doTest() throws Exception {
+    // Use a list to ensure objects must be allocated.
+    ArrayList<Object> l = new ArrayList<>(100);
+
+    setupObjectFreeCallback();
+
+    enableFreeTracking(true);
+    run(l);
+
+    enableFreeTracking(false);
+    run(l);
+  }
+
+  private static void run(ArrayList<Object> l) {
+    allocate(l, 1);
+    l.clear();
+
+    Runtime.getRuntime().gc();
+
+    System.out.println("---");
+
+    // Note: the reporting will not depend on the heap layout (which could be unstable). Walking
+    //       the tag table should give us a stable output order.
+    for (int i = 10; i <= 1000; i *= 10) {
+      allocate(l, i);
+    }
+    l.clear();
+
+    Runtime.getRuntime().gc();
+
+    System.out.println("---");
+
+    Runtime.getRuntime().gc();
+
+    System.out.println("---");
+  }
+
+  private static void allocate(ArrayList<Object> l, long tag) {
+    Object obj = new Object();
+    l.add(obj);
+    setTag(obj, tag);
+  }
+
+  private static native void setupObjectFreeCallback();
+  private static native void enableFreeTracking(boolean enable);
+  private static native void setTag(Object o, long tag);
+}
diff --git a/test/905-object-free/tracking_free.cc b/test/905-object-free/tracking_free.cc
new file mode 100644
index 0000000..5905d48
--- /dev/null
+++ b/test/905-object-free/tracking_free.cc
@@ -0,0 +1,79 @@
+/*
+ * Copyright (C) 2013 The Android Open Source Project
+ *
+ * Licensed under the Apache License, Version 2.0 (the "License");
+ * you may not use this file except in compliance with the License.
+ * You may obtain a copy of the License at
+ *
+ *      http://www.apache.org/licenses/LICENSE-2.0
+ *
+ * Unless required by applicable law or agreed to in writing, software
+ * distributed under the License is distributed on an "AS IS" BASIS,
+ * WITHOUT WARRANTIES OR CONDITIONS OF ANY KIND, either express or implied.
+ * See the License for the specific language governing permissions and
+ * limitations under the License.
+ */
+
+#include "tracking_free.h"
+
+#include <iostream>
+#include <pthread.h>
+#include <stdio.h>
+#include <vector>
+
+#include "base/logging.h"
+#include "jni.h"
+#include "openjdkjvmti/jvmti.h"
+#include "ScopedLocalRef.h"
+#include "ScopedUtfChars.h"
+#include "ti-agent/common_load.h"
+#include "utils.h"
+
+namespace art {
+namespace Test905ObjectFree {
+
+static void JNICALL ObjectFree(jvmtiEnv* ti_env ATTRIBUTE_UNUSED, jlong tag) {
+  printf("ObjectFree tag=%zu\n", static_cast<size_t>(tag));
+}
+
+extern "C" JNIEXPORT void JNICALL Java_Main_setupObjectFreeCallback(
+    JNIEnv* env ATTRIBUTE_UNUSED, jclass klass ATTRIBUTE_UNUSED) {
+  jvmtiEventCallbacks callbacks;
+  memset(&callbacks, 0, sizeof(jvmtiEventCallbacks));
+  callbacks.ObjectFree = ObjectFree;
+
+  jvmtiError ret = jvmti_env->SetEventCallbacks(&callbacks, sizeof(callbacks));
+  if (ret != JVMTI_ERROR_NONE) {
+    char* err;
+    jvmti_env->GetErrorName(ret, &err);
+    printf("Error setting callbacks: %s\n", err);
+  }
+}
+
+extern "C" JNIEXPORT void JNICALL Java_Main_enableFreeTracking(JNIEnv* env ATTRIBUTE_UNUSED,
+                                                               jclass klass ATTRIBUTE_UNUSED,
+                                                               jboolean enable) {
+  jvmtiError ret = jvmti_env->SetEventNotificationMode(
+      enable ? JVMTI_ENABLE : JVMTI_DISABLE,
+      JVMTI_EVENT_OBJECT_FREE,
+      nullptr);
+  if (ret != JVMTI_ERROR_NONE) {
+    char* err;
+    jvmti_env->GetErrorName(ret, &err);
+    printf("Error enabling/disabling object-free callbacks: %s\n", err);
+  }
+}
+
+// Don't do anything
+jint OnLoad(JavaVM* vm,
+            char* options ATTRIBUTE_UNUSED,
+            void* reserved ATTRIBUTE_UNUSED) {
+  if (vm->GetEnv(reinterpret_cast<void**>(&jvmti_env), JVMTI_VERSION_1_0)) {
+    printf("Unable to get jvmti env!\n");
+    return 1;
+  }
+  return 0;
+}
+
+}  // namespace Test905ObjectFree
+}  // namespace art
